The Earth’s wild places are under threat like never before from unprecedented human destruction and degradation. The fight to protect these last wild places and secure the future of life on our planet is unfolding now. As the home to 25% of the world’s wetlands and boreal forests, 20% of the world’s freshwater, and the world’s longest coastline, Canada could make a massive contribution to securing the future of life on the planet by doubling its protected natural landscapes.

This video was created for the Nature Champions Summit hosted by the Canadian government in April 2019. The event gathered nature champions from around the world in anticipation of the 15th Conference of the Parties to the Convention on Biodiversity which will take place in Beijing in October 2020. There, global leaders will set a strategic plan to protect nature and people.
